Westpac Banking Corp lifted its stake in shares of American Homes 4 Rent (NYSE:AMH – Free Report) by 20.2% in the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 127,413 shares of the real estate investment trust’s stock after acquiring an additional 21,391 shares during the quarter. Westpac Banking Corp’s holdings in American Homes 4 Rent were worth $3,557,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

American Homes 4 Rent Stock Down 1.1%
American Homes 4 Rent (NYSE:AMH –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, May 6th. The real estate investment trust reported $0.48 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.18 by $0.30. American Homes 4 Rent had a return on equity of 6.08% and a net margin of 25.27%.The firm had revenue of $472.02 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$470.62 million. During the same period last year, the company posted $0.46 EPS.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 2.8% compared to the same quarter last year. American Homes 4 Rent has set its FY 2026 guidance at 1.890-1.950 EPS. On average, sell-side analysts forecast that American Homes 4 Rent will post 1.88 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
American Homes 4 Rent Announces Dividend
The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Tuesday, June 30th. Stockholders of record on Monday, June 15th were given a $0.33 dividend. This represents a $1.32 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 4.0%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Monday, June 15th. American Homes 4 Rent’s dividend payout ratio is 107.32%.

American Homes 4 Rent Company Profile
American Homes 4 Rent (NYSE: AMH) is a publicly traded real estate investment trust (REIT) specializing in the acquisition, development and management of single-family rental homes. Since its initial public offering in April 2013, the company has focused on building a large-scale, professionally managed portfolio of homes designed to meet the needs of today’s renters. Its business model emphasizes the acquisition of well-located properties coupled with consistent, in-house property management to drive occupancy and long-term value.
As of the most recent reporting, American Homes 4 Rent owns and operates tens of thousands of homes across the United States, with concentration in key Sun Belt and high-growth markets.
